Helicobacter pylori (H. pylori), a common bacterium residing in the stomach lining, has been linked to a significant proportion of stomach cancer cases worldwide. A study published in Nature Medicine estimates that nearly 76% of gastric cancers may be attributable to H. pylori, with around 12 million cases expected among those born between 2008 and…

Mental health problems are not limited to younger people; they are increasingly common among older adults, too. A study published in the British Journal of General Practice found that nearly one in five people aged 55 and above living in the community had a mental health disorder recorded by their GP. Coffee grounds, commonly discarded after brewing, are a surprisingly valuable resource for your garden. Packed with nutrients like nitrogen, phosphorus, potassium, and trace minerals, they act as a natural fertiliser, improving soil fertility and promoting healthier plant growth. Cholesterol often gets a bad reputation, but it plays a crucial role in the body. It helps build healthy cells, produces essential hormones like estrogen and testosterone, and aids digestion through bile production.
